Sign In — Free (10 views/day)ANGELS BASEBALL FOUNDATION INC, founded in 2004, is a community nonprofit in the Recreation & Sports sector that reported $4.0M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ue surged 68%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$2.4M, a strong 59% operating margin.

| Year | Revenue | Expenses | Assets | Net Income |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| No data | No data | No data | No data |
| 2023 | $4,016,411 | $1,640,867 | $15,448,836 | $2,375,544 |
| 2022 | $2,388,781 | $1,340,981 | $12,929,183 | $1,047,800 |
| 2021 | $3,125,940 | $1,160,355 | $12,036,127 | $1,965,585 |
| 2020 | $2,821,298 | $1,487,652 | $10,111,601 | $1,333,646 |
| 2019 | $2,986,875 | $1,587,836 | $8,680,416 | $1,399,039 |
| 2018 | $2,523,957 | $2,000,686 | $7,346,152 | $523,271 |
